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7099867 006900089 926173826
1381129 2120 779
1381129 2120 779
1054771 43 069572
All about undefined
Interested in learning more?
1381129 2120 779
1054771 43 069572
See more
12 606 54
767108176 849085529 045 19650
See more
7297 36081119 22527870
523 0963001 3080495
See more